The 10 best beach hotels in Balapitiya, Sri Lanka | Booking.com
Skip to main content

Beach Hotels in Balapitiya

Find the beach hotels that appeal to you the most

The best beach hotels in Balapitiya

Check out our pick of great beach hotels in Balapitiya

Filter by:

Review score

Sundara by Mosvold

Hotel in Balapitiya

Set in Balapitiya, 300 metres from Balapitiya Beach, Sundara by Mosvold offers accommodation with an outdoor swimming pool, free private parking, a garden and a private beach area.

T
Thor
From
Norway
Lovely place and very kind and smiley staff
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 161 reviews
Price from
US$261
1 night, 2 adults

Sweet Pea Homestay

Balapitiya

Set in Balapitiya, 2.2 km from Balapitiya Beach, Sweet Pea Homestay has a private beach area, private parking and rooms with free WiFi access.

J
Johanna
From
Germany
Piumi and her family were super nice and helped with everything. The room was great, the beach was less than 5 minutes away and the food, which was home cooked, was fantastic. We had a great stay.
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 66 reviews
Price from
US$17
1 night, 2 adults

Villa Carla

Balapitiya

Providing free WiFi, private parking and a private beach area, the recently renovated property of Villa Carla, offers rooms in Balapitiya, 2.1 km from Ambalangoda Beach and 37 km from Galle...

V
Vitali
From
Estonia
We stayed at Villa Carla for 17 nights, everything was great! Very nice staff, many thanks to them! For people who like a relaxing holiday without fuss and noise. We will come back here again!
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 82 reviews
Price from
US$63.80
1 night, 2 adults

Bay Villas Balapitiya

Balapitiya

Featuring a balcony with sea views, a private beach area and a garden, Bay Villas Balapitiya can be found in Balapitiya, close to Ambalangoda Beach and 35 km from Galle International Cricket Stadium.

J
Juergen
From
Germany
We couldn't have wished for a better start to our holiday than here at Bay Villas Balapitya. here the guests are carried on hands, all wishes are fulfilled immediately it's like paradise on earth. we quickly took the manager Leonard Josef to our hearts and the entire team is extremely lovely. everything was perfect. the chef cook Viktor joseph spoiled our palates with Sri Lankan specialities and delighted us every day with new delicacies. Angelika after four days in the Bay Villas i can say: i didn't find it good at all - because "good" is far too small a term for the all-embracing bliss with which one leaves this place. the great humour and quick-wittedness of leonard contributes to this in no small measure. i got on very well with him 09.01.2023 Jürgen
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 76 reviews
Price from
US$175
1 night, 2 adults

Kumu Beach

Hotel in Balapitiya

Offering an outdoor pool and sun deck, Kumu Beach is situated in Balapitiya in the Galle District Region. There is a shared lounge at the property.

M
Marinko
From
Croatia
Amazing resort, with wonderful, big, green property next to the amazing beach. Garden is quite spacious, with the open view of the ocean and sunsets. Lounge chaies are spread around the gardens, so you can enjoy the conversations with your fellow guests, or choose the remote corners for the peace and tranquility and enjoying sound of waves on your own, or with your partner. The pool is very large, and never crowded, as this 10-room resort offers plenty of space to make you feel very comfortable. If resort is full, make sure to get the lounge chair early, but if you are not there all the time, you can finnd your stuff moved away by some rude guest. Beach so beautiful, as it breaks the monotony of the long beach with massive boulders right in front of resort. Rooms are very nice, but lower priced rooms are little bit smaller than expected. Nevertheless, the bathroom is wonderful and spacious and both are very well designed. One thing that is missing in those rooms is privacy of the balcony. Breakfast is wonderful starting with the fruit platter, bakery basket and then a-la-carte option, which is second to none, with local and international variety. Dinner menu is not huge, but with well chosen dishes and affordable. Definitely a place to visit again.
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 75 reviews
Price from
US$152.12
1 night, 2 adults

Aavya Cove Villas by Aahaasa

Hotel in Balapitiya

Offering an outdoor pool and a restaurant, Aavya Cove Villas are located in Balapitiya. Free WiFi access is available and rooms feature air conditioning and a patio.

m
mino S
From
Slovakia
Everything about the Calamansi Cove Villas was great. It was clean, stylish, located on a quiet beachfront, just a few steps from golden sands and calm blue waves. During our stay, we enjoyed the tranquility of the place, beautiful green sceneries in the gardens and local atmosphere at the beach. The staff at the resort was attentive, polite and friendly. Even though we arrived very early in the morning (due to some travel issues) the manager (Mr. Samitha) helped us with no delay with a room. The kitchen here is great and we had to try almost everything on the menu, including the local specialities. Our thanks go also to all the nice people at the reception, restaurant, lifeguard and housekeeping (Janith, Omesh, Hasitha, Sadiqi and Niro 🙏). If you are looking for a quiet and secluded place to calm down and relax, with excellent services - this is the place to go.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 61 reviews
Price from
US$125.78
1 night, 2 adults

Villa Balapitiya Beach

Balapitiya

Situated in Balapitiya and only 70 metres from Ambalangoda Beach, Villa Balapitiya Beach features accommodation with sea views, free WiFi and free private parking.

P
Polina
From
Ukraine
There are places you visit… and then there are places that touch something deeper. This villa is not just accommodation — it’s an experience filled with soul, silence, and softness. Every little detail — from the cozy interiors to the peaceful garden — made me feel not like a guest, but like someone coming home. The energy of the place is calm and kind — it holds you gently. A big part of this magic comes from the host. From the moment I arrived, I felt welcomed. Nalinda met me with such warmth — kind, calm, genuinely attentive. He explained everything with care and created a space where I could simply breathe and be. Respectful, present, with a spark of something rare — you can feel this place is loved. And you’re lucky to step into that space. He’s the kind of host who leaves a quiet impression — the kind you remember long after you leave. Breakfasts were beyond delicious — fresh, local, made with attention and soul. Every morning felt like a gentle invitation to slow down and enjoy life. The garden is full of life — lush greenery, cinnamon trees, soft air. The ocean is just 50 meters away — and the beach is so quiet and beautiful, it truly feels like it’s all yours. This is a place of peace and beauty — perfect for those who seek true rest, far from noisy crowds. An authentic villa, a pool, nature, and a sense of care. Thank you for making me feel safe, seen, and softly spoiled. I will carry this feeling with me — and something tells me, this is not goodbye… just a beautiful pause. With all my heart, 🕊️
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 8 reviews
Price from
US$64
1 night, 2 adults

villa pantano

Balapitiya

Providing free WiFi, private parking and a private beach area, the recently renovated property of villa pantano, offers rooms in Balapitiya, 2.1 km from Ambalangoda Beach and 37 km from Galle...

A
Alison
From
United Kingdom
The property is very well presented with large bedroom & bathroom & terrace - the breakfast was served just outside our room. The swimming was excellent and well maintained and warm. The staff were very welcoming and worked hard to keep us all happy. The beach was a 5 min walk and is stunning - very natural and untouched. The wifi worked in the whole of the hotel.
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 23 reviews
Price from
US$26.60
1 night, 2 adults

Ocean Caves, Balapitiya

Balapitiya

Located in Balapitiya, just 600 metres from Ambalangoda Beach, Ocean Caves, Balapitiya provides beachfront accommodation with a private beach area, water sports facilities, pool with a view and free...

T
Tony
From
United Kingdom
Wonderfull ❤️ Such a beautiful place, Amazing beach 80 metres away, Lovely food, Absolutely Wonderful Staff, They made everything Great for us. Thank you from Gill & Tony Skingle
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 70 reviews
Price from
US$40
1 night, 2 adults

Shinagawa Beach

Hotel in Balapitiya

Offering an outdoor pool and a spa and wellness centre, Shinagawa Beach Hotel provides a relaxing stay in beautiful accommodation in Balapitiya.

N
Nikolay
From
Russia
This hotel is a pure sweet spot: a combination beautiful sandy beach with nice ocean view through palm trees, excellent and well-trained staff, huge variety of very tasty food, comfortable rooms and excellent management with focus on sustainability. We booked a room with breakfast and intended to dine outside, however upon our arrival a hotel manager Mr Fernando warmly welcomed us and recommended to try dinner buffet... And we did - the best experience (both breakfast and dinner) comparing 5 hotels in Sri-Lanka we visited during our 3 weeks vacation. Additional compliment to the way the hotel is managed - exceptional level of service, safety, sustainability and attention to the guests needs. I can't put in a review all the things we're positevely surprised with this hotel - it far exceeded our expectations, definitely recommend to stay here!
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 78 reviews
Price from
US$265
1 night, 2 adults
All beach hotels in Balapitiya

Looking for a beach hotel?

There’s nothing quite like waking up to the sound of swirling waves and the smell of sea air through your bedroom window. Beachfront accommodation comes in a variety of forms, from well decked-out resorts to secluded homestays and villas. Beach hotel amenities can include air-conditioned rooms, private terraces overlooking the sea and outdoor pools with adjacent bars.

Most booked beach hotels in Balapitiya and surroundings in the past month

See all

FAQ about beach hotels in Balapitiya

Beach hotels that guests love in Balapitiya

See all
  • Avg. price/night: US$288.84
    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 78 reviews
    Fabulous beach hotel. The staff were attentive and always happy to cater to our needs. The room was clean, comfortable and perfect view. The food was delicious and flavourful. The grounds are neatly kept. During our stay, there were many other couples enjoying their stay, in a comfortable quiet and relaxing atmosphere. No kids to be seen which made it even more wonderful to unwind. We will be back.
    Guest review by
    Linda
    Young couple
  • Avg. price/night: US$327.04
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 161 reviews
    Very nice and comfortable atmosphere. Due to the small size and the location without any other bigger hotels around, this place feels very secluded and quite. When staying a few nights, it is very easy to connect to other guest or enjoy complete privacy. The beach is beautiful and sunsets are amazing. We would come back surely.
    Guest review by
    Arne
    Family with young children
  • Avg. price/night: US$73.88
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 82 reviews
    Amazing! We had several hotels, apartments in Sri Lanka but this was the best. We felt great there the location is amazing, right on the beutiful beach. There were some waves but you can swim or you can use a nice pool as well. The staff was so kind and helpful. The breakfast was great they brought a table for us and we had it in front of our room in the garden while listening the sounds of the ocean. There were shops, pharmacy, restaurants nearby. Looking forward to be there next time.
    Guest review by
    Ferenc
    Young couple
  • Avg. price/night: US$73.88
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 82 reviews
    Amazing! We had several hotels, apartments in Sri Lanka but this was the best. We felt great there the location is amazing, right on the beutiful beach. There were some waves but you can swim or you can use a nice pool as well. The staff was so kind and helpful. The breakfast was great they brought a table for us and we had it in front of our room in the garden while listening the sounds of the ocean. There were shops, pharmacy, restaurants nearby. Looking forward to be there next time.
    Guest review by
    Ferenc
    Young couple
  • Avg. price/night: US$327.04
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 161 reviews
    THE LOCATION WAS FANTASTIC, WEST FACING SO LOVELY SUNSETS. YOU COULD WALK FOR SEVERAL MILES IN BOTH DIRECTIONS ON THE BEACH WHICH WAS PERFECT. HOTEL LAYOUT WAS VERY GOOD. WE COULD HAVE BREAKFAST ON OUR OWN TERRACE IF WE WANTED. STAFF WERE ALL VERY FRIENDLY AND KEEN TO HELP. FOOD ON THE WHOLE WAS VERY GOOD BUT THE MENU DID NOT CHANGE.
    Guest review by
    Philippa
    Young couple
  • Avg. price/night: US$509.55
    Scored out of 10, guest rating 9.1
    Superb - What previous guests thought, 61 reviews
    We could not have landed up at a better place, this is a true gem, hidden away with great food and the most amazing beach - we decided to stay there at the last minute because we had originally booked a big hotel, but we were just dying for some peace and quiet after traveling around the country. We could not have been more delighted when we arrived at sunset to a beautiful beachfront and pool direct from our villa. Definitely coming back. Great staff and a real hideaway - a very special place. Thank you.
    Guest review by
    John
    Young couple
  • Avg. price/night: US$327.04
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 161 reviews
    We had a wonderful stay at the Sundara - not only the property is beautiful and well cared for but also the staff did an exceptional job in making us feel welcome and at home. Prasad helps with bookings of massages or tours, Hassan and his colleagues don’t leave any gastronomical wishes open. Everyone is friendly and caring. We enjoyed swimming in the nice pool, the spacious rooms, the delicious food & drinks and the direct beach access. We swam in the ocean, but check the tides before as waves can be quite high.
    Guest review by
    Cristina
    Young couple
  • Avg. price/night: US$73.88
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 82 reviews
    Good breakfast ,exceptional and friendly helpful staff. Right on the beach .jst likehaving your own personal staff at your own personal villa. Will return again very soon
    Guest review by
    Jane
    Group